    Kamel Daoud is an Algerian doctor, vice-president of the Algerian League for the Defense of Human Rights (LADDH) since 2004, in charge of external relations, representative of the wilaya of Algiers. How to do it? He was for a time acting secretary general of the Front of Socialist Forces. During the 2007 struggle for control of the LADDH, he supported Mustapha Bouchachi as president against Hocine Zehouane. In 2008, he intervened several times on the phenomenon of harragas. During the Algerian protests of 2011, he repeatedly criticized the LADDH’s approach to participation in the Coordination for Change and Democracy, considering it inappropriate and subservient to the Rally for Culture and Democracy.
